Many property owners wait too long before addressing asphalt maintenance. Knowing the warning signs helps you act early and avoid costly damage.
Visual Signs Your Asphalt Needs Attention
Look for:
Fading or gray coloration
Hairline or spreading cracks
Rough or dry surface texture
Small areas of surface erosion
These signs indicate oxidation and moisture exposure.
Functional Red Flags
If you notice:
Water pooling instead of draining
Loose aggregate on the surface
Cracks that grow after winter
Uneven or deteriorating edges
Your asphalt may already be compromised.
Timing Matters
Seal coating should be applied:
When asphalt is structurally sound
Before cracks become widespread
During proper weather conditions
